One Golden Summer...
When Toronto food stylist Leah Carter agrees to run her aunt's bakery in Prince Edward County for two months, she tells herself it's a pit stop—a summer of flour, lake breezes, and an easy escape back to the city.
Then she runs into Noah Barrett—her first love, now a rising winemaker with a reputation as "the Prince of the County." His pitch is simple: partner with him for the Harvest Festival, pairing her pastries with his wines. The catch? Three weekends of long hours, public eyes, and the kind of closeness they've avoided for nearly a decade.
As festival season heats up, so does everything Leah thought she'd left behind: the easy rhythm of small-town mornings, the thrill of creating something that matters, and the pull toward a man who still knows exactly how she takes her coffee. But rivals are circling, supplies go missing, and a tempting offer from Toronto could derail more than just their booth.
With the lake as their witness, Leah and Noah will have to decide if this is just a summer worth remembering—or the start of a life worth building.
Full of farmers' market mornings, vineyard sunsets, and second chances, One Golden Summer is a sweeping romance about finding the courage to stay when every instinct tells you to run.
